The AI disruption is transforming not only the business but also the way we live, we work, and we socialize. However, its impact in Cities and Regions seems to be limited. Here we will analyze some policies aimed at fostering AI in Cities and Regions (Barcelona, Finland and Catalonia) together with an example of the use of digital twins in cities, developed by 300.000Km/s.
This Side Event was part of the program "Focus Sessions #1 – Local actions tackling global challenges".
